In a Manhattan courtroom yesterday, the legendary Sean "Diddy" Combs (55), sporting a bleak visage, was facing fresh allegations of sexual misconduct, leaving spectators and media outlets alike wondering about his emotional state. The New York Post described his appearance as tumbling down the abyss of despair.

The Pawn in a Prolonged Battle

A distressing look of fatigue graced Combs' countenance, his once vibrant auburn hair now streaked with silver, and a bloated appearance that seemed at odds with his usual charisma. After pleading not guilty to the renewed charges, the trial against the former music tycoon has been scheduled for May 12, with jury selection commencing on May 5, as reported by U.S. media.

Earlier reports detailed claims made by Combs' employees, accusing him of emotional and physical abuse, and compelling one or more to partake in inappropriate acts. People magazine had published an indictment detailing these allegations.

Combs was arrested in New York in 2024 and has been imprisoned at the Metropolitan Detention Center in Brooklyn since. He stands accused of various charges including sex trafficking, coercion, and rape. In addition, he faces numerous civil lawsuits, with his legal defense team dismissing the accusations as baseless attempts at extorting payment from celebrity figures fearing false rumors might spread. A life sentence looms if convicted.
